The Spanish word curvo is a fundamental adjective used to describe anything that deviates from a straight line in a smooth, continuous fashion. At its core, it translates to 'curved' in English. It is a versatile term that spans across various domains, from basic geometry and physical descriptions to complex architectural theories and abstract metaphors. When you look at the world, you realize that nature rarely uses perfectly straight lines; instead, it favors the curvo. From the gentle arc of a horizon to the intricate spirals of a seashell, this word captures the essence of fluid form. In everyday Spanish, you will use it to describe physical objects like a bent pipe, a winding road, or even the shape of a person's posture. Understanding curvo is essential because it provides the necessary contrast to recto (straight), allowing for a complete spatial description of the environment around you.

Using curvo correctly requires attention to basic Spanish grammar rules, specifically adjective agreement and placement. As an adjective, it must match the noun it describes in both gender (masculine/feminine) and number (singular/plural). In most standard descriptions, curvo follows the noun it modifies, which is the typical pattern for descriptive adjectives in Spanish. For example, 'un puente curvo' (a curved bridge) or 'una superficie curva' (a curved surface). However, in poetic or literary contexts, it might occasionally precede the noun to emphasize the quality of the object, though this is much less common in daily speech.
- Gender Agreement
- Masculine: El arco es curvo. Feminine: La pared es curva.
- Number Agreement
- Singular: El monitor es curvo. Plural: Los monitores son curvos.
Compré una pantalla curva para mi computadora nueva.
When using curvo with verbs, it most frequently appears with 'ser' because the curvature is usually an inherent, permanent characteristic of the object. For instance, 'La carretera es curva' implies that the road was built that way. If you were to use 'estar', it might imply a temporary state or a change in condition, such as 'El metal está curvo por el calor' (The metal is curved/bent because of the heat). This distinction is vital for conveying the correct nuance. Furthermore, curvo can be modified by adverbs to provide more detail, such as 'ligeramente curvo' (slightly curved) or 'muy curvo' (very curved).

One of the most frequent errors English speakers make when using curvo is confusing the adjective with the noun curva. In English, 'curve' can be both a noun and a verb, and 'curved' is the adjective. In Spanish, these are distinct. 'Curvo' is exclusively an adjective. If you want to say 'the curve of the road', you must use 'la curva de la carretera'. If you want to say 'the road is curved', you use 'la carretera es curva'. Beginners often say 'la carretera es una curva', which literally means 'the road is a curve', which is grammatically possible but often not what they intend to say. Another common mistake is failing to apply gender agreement, especially since 'curvo' ends in '-o', leading students to accidentally use the masculine form for feminine nouns like 'línea' or 'superficie'.
- Adjective vs. Noun
- Mistake: 'El objeto es una curva.' Correct: 'El objeto es curvo.' (Unless the object literally is a curve in a geometric sense).
- Gender Mismatch
- Mistake: 'La pantalla es curvo.' Correct: 'La pantalla es curva.'
Incorrecto: Esa pared es muy curvo. Correcto: Esa pared es muy curva.
Another nuanced mistake involves the choice between curvo and synonyms like torcido or doblado. 'Curvo' implies a smooth, often intentional arc. 'Torcido' (twisted/crooked) usually implies something that should be straight but isn't, often suggesting a defect or damage. 'Doblado' (bent/folded) implies that a force was applied to change the shape, like a bent wire. If you describe a beautiful architectural arch as 'torcido', it sounds like a criticism of the construction quality rather than a description of its shape. Similarly, using curvo to describe a person's hunchback is less common than using 'encorvado'. Be mindful of the 'intentionality' or 'naturalness' that curvo conveys compared to its more 'forceful' or 'accidental' synonyms.

While curvo is the most general and common term for 'curved', Spanish offers a rich palette of synonyms that can provide more specific imagery. Arqueado, for example, specifically means 'arched', like the shape of a bow or a structural arch. It suggests a more deliberate, architectural, or tension-filled curve. Sinuoso describes something with many curves, like a snake or a winding river; it implies a 'serpentine' or 'winding' quality. Redondeado means 'rounded' and is often used for corners or edges that have been smoothed down. Understanding these nuances allows you to be much more descriptive in your Spanish prose or conversation.
- Curvo vs. Arqueado
- 'Curvo' is any bend. 'Arqueado' is specifically like an arch (arco). Example: 'Cejas arqueadas' (arched eyebrows).
- Curvo vs. Sinuoso
- 'Curvo' can be a single arc. 'Sinuoso' implies multiple, alternating curves. Example: 'Un río sinuoso'.
El diseño sinuoso del sendero es muy relajante.
Other technical terms include cóncavo (concave) and convexo (convex), which describe the direction of the curve relative to the observer. These are essential in optics and geometry. If you want to describe something that is wavy, you would use ondulado. If something is bent out of shape due to pressure or heat, combado (warped) is the appropriate term, often used for wood or metal. Finally, circular is a specific type of curve that forms a complete circle. By choosing the right alternative, you can convey whether a curve is natural, structural, accidental, or mathematically precise.

From the Latin word 'curvus', which means bent, arched, or crooked. It has been part of the Spanish language since its early development from Vulgar Latin.
Sens originel : Bent or arched.
Indo-European -> Italic -> Romance -> Spanish.Contexte culturel
Be careful using 'curvo' or 'con curvas' when describing people, as it can be perceived as commenting on their body shape.
English speakers often use 'curvy' for people and 'curved' for objects. In Spanish, 'curvo' is mostly for objects/lines, while 'con curvas' is for people.
